1) Which of the following is incorrectly matched?
A) endogenic — internal processes
B) exogenic — external processes
C) radioactive decay heat — exogenic energy source
D) weathering — exogenic breaking and dissolving the crust - Correct answer-C
2) When geologists conclude that the Grand Canyon sequence of rocks was formed
through hundreds of millions of years of deposition, mountain building, and
erosion, they are basing this conclusion on the principle of ________ which states
that ________.
A) catastrophism; most rock formations were created as a result of supernatural
processes
B) catastrophism; a single, large flood was responsible for the creation of the rock
sequence
,C) uniformitarianism; all geologic processes take immense amounts of time to
occur and always occur at the same rate
D) uniformitarianism; the geologic processes that operated in the past are the same
as those that operate today, and they occurred in accordance with the same laws of
nature that are operating today - Correct answer-D
3) Earth's interior is layered because...
A) centrifugal force separated out the materials based on weight as the Earth
solidified.
B) materials became sorted based on density as the Earth solidified.
C) materials became sorted based on electromagnetic fields as the Earth solidified.
- Correct answer-B
4) Which of the following gives the correct sequence of layers in Earth, from the
surface to the center?
A) crust, inner core, mantle, outer core
B) inner core, outer core, mantle, crust
C) mantle, crust, inner core, outer core
D) crust, mantle, outer core, inner core - Correct answer-D
, 5) The density of material below the Moho is ________ that above it.
A) greater than
B) less than
C) the same as - Correct answer-A
6) On average, the thickness of oceanic crust is ________ that of continental crust.
A) greater than
B) less than
C) the same as - Correct answer-B
7) A rock transformed from any other rock through extreme heat and or pressure is
referred to as
A) sedimentary.
B) metamorphic.
C) igneous.
D) ancient. - Correct answer-B
